Hi all, I have been a Dreamcast user since the launch and love it dearly. It was the Dreamcast that made me want to pursue a career in game design. My first university degree is in Computer Arts and I worked very briefly in the games industry as a 3D artist.
My programming knowledge is basic so please excuse me if this is unachievable. Whilst I was studying at university for one of my projects I used a simple and free 3d engine called 3impact. I know people have ported games to the Dreamcast but would it be possible to port an engine to the dreamcast? I have been waiting for a 3D engine for the dreamcast for years so I can put my 3d skills to use on the Dreamcast.
